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

v1.2 #157

Merged
merged 97 commits into from Aug 11, 2019
Merged

v1.2 #157

merged 97 commits into from Aug 11, 2019

Conversation

@tiotdev
Copy link
Member

tiotdev commented Aug 11, 2019

New features:

  • Completely new Publish page with tons of new features:
    • New EasyEditor: editor.js -> Prettier and better block-based editor, video integration #140
    • New Markdown editor: react-markdown-editor-lite -> Adds image upload feature, side-by-side editing/preview, toolbar. Thanks to @harry-heightz for the feedback.
    • Publish page now works great on mobile #24
    • Add advanced/expert options to editor #122
      -> Add permlink picker #116
      -> Add beneficiary picker
      -> Add payout type picker. Thanks to @harry-heightz for the feedback.
      -> Add language picker
    • Add button for saving draft #102
    • Suggest relevant tags in tag picker
    • Preview shows exactly how the post will render on TravelFeed
    • Location picker can now pick a location category (country/subdivision/city/suburb)
    • Checklist lists the quality requirements and checks for issues (word count, missing title,..). Reworked quality requirements as well.
  • Implement login with Steem Keychain #155
  • Add swipeable drawer menu for TravelBlog that takes no space #71

Bug fixes and improvements:

  • Improve date display to show month and year instead of 'x months/years ago' - thanks to @livinguktaiwan for the suggestion
  • Posting with Steem Keychain throws error 'incomplete' bonustrack/steemconnect.js#70 -> Custom keychain implementation to fix steemconnect-js bug
  • Location is not restored when editing post #129
  • Title validation allows invalid permlink to be added to broadcast #115 thanks to @tobias-g1 for reporting!
  • API returns 500 when duplicate permalink provided #114 thanks to @tobias-g1 for reporting!
  • Cannot create tags with "-" in tag picker #98
  • Location picker search problems #96
  • Do not count subtitles in editor word count #110 thanks to @jwolf for reporting
  • When post is too short or missing a title, display a popup instead of a tooltip #105 -> Display a checklist
  • Fix location picker search on mobile #101
  • Editor placeholder too wide on mobile #69
  • Tag picker not working for custom tags on mobile #68
  • Editor problems #67
  • Data is not re-queried when navigating back in PWA #64
  • Cannot edit posts with parent_permlink !== "travelfeed" #118
  • Fix table and quote colors in dark mode
  • Fix content rendering problems
  • Do not save edited posts as drafts
  • Fix empty tags in tag picker
tiotdev and others added 27 commits Aug 9, 2019
Prevents jumping markers
Opens image instead of general file picker on mobile devices
@tiotdev tiotdev added this to the 2.0 Beta milestone Aug 11, 2019
@tiotdev tiotdev merged commit 2ccaa64 into master Aug 11, 2019
1 check failed
1 check failed
SonarCloud Code Analysis Quality Gate failed
Details
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
2 participants
You can’t perform that action at this time.